What kind of kefir is best? When sourcing kefir to help with IBS, depression or anxiety, look for a live, active, traditional-style kefir, rather than a supermarket probiotic, which may be pasteur- ised after production. Choose kefir that’s made with real kefir grains; if it doesn’t say on the label that it’s made with real grains, it probably isn’t. Goats’ milk is the best base for
kefir, as the A1 casein in cows’ milk is allergenic and can cause inflamma- tion inside the gut. Avoid flavoured or sweetened kefir, as sugar and sweeteners can further damage your microbiome. If you wish to flavour your kefir at home, use 100% pure stevia and fruit, blending and
consuming immediately to avoid degradation of the probiotics. Kefir suitable for use to deal with
